Magento - Setup Store Live

This chapter shows how to setup the live store on your Magento website.
Step (1): Login to your Magento Admin Panel.
Step (2): Go to System menu and click on the Manage Stores option.

Magento Setup Store Live Step (3): Under Manage Stores section, you will get website names, store names and Store View Name columns. Click on the Create Store button to begin with setting up the Magento live store.
Magento Setup Store Live Step (4): The store information includes some options such as:
  • Website which allows selecting the website name which you created before
  • Name option specifies name of your second website name
  • Root Category option specifies the root category that will be used for store.
Magento Setup Store Live After done with the settings, click on the Save Store button.
